Any push for skin healthy sanitizer and soap? (self.starbucksbaristas)
submitted by collinscreen
The sodium laurel sulfate in the commercial soap that we have to use and the sanitizer solution dries out my hands. I’m pretty sure people avoid all of the recommended hand washes because of how bad this stuff will dry out your hands. And yeah, you could wear gloves, but during peak you can’t change the gloves too quickly (and even less quickly if understaffed/no C.S.). That and you can get milk, sauces, and syrups in the gloves.

Is anybody pushing for more skin healthy sanitizer and soap? This is just one reason why Starbucks needs to be the corporation that reintroduces workplace democracy to the United States

I’d suggest talking to your manager. Mine lets me buy soap and bring it in. I have eczema and starbucks soap demolishes my hands so my manager let me buy some from CVS to use. I recommend finding something plant based with no fragrances

You need lotion to use when you go on your 30 and lotion at home, keep it in the bathroom and kitchen sink next to the soap, and get into the habit of using it.

If your store doesn’t provide reusable dish washing gloves 🧤, pick yourself up a pair for when you do dishes or drains.

My store has soapbox soap-sea minerals & blue iris now. I have Dyshidrotic Eczema on my hands from washing them so much. My manager lets me bring my own soap...as long as it's unscented. Just picked up some dial that's unscented from Walgreens! Also, use unscented lotion asap after washing/gloves if handling sanitizer. I use one gloved hand when I'm handling cash. I'm washing my hands so much they are cracked/bleeding. My derm prescribed me a steroid ointment. Not washing my hands every 30mins LOL. That being said I'm washing my hands when necessary for food safety. My manager ordered unscented lotion for everyone. ♥ ♥ ♥
